Output e5ecd176598ee4b301c19b68ea69ea4940ebe449d24ceb94e5797b53a3aec741:0

value
119019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9af73c4784e0b782d76c7f27e2dc33dd2d9c2d30 OP_EQUAL
address
3FpQAJkyHXrwWYx6MLyAdr2XfM4NYbJjHA
transaction
e5ecd176598ee4b301c19b68ea69ea4940ebe449d24ceb94e5797b53a3aec741
confirmations
452667
spent
true